Transaction 69062760541b44cc6cd074d8c6164af7a3f413e6e72faa894f79a79536250e4d
1 Input
1 Output
-
69062760541b44cc6cd074d8c6164af7a3f413e6e72faa894f79a79536250e4d:0
- value
- 505104
- script pubkey
- OP_0 OP_PUSHBYTES_20 29cb24ac779309f3c64b8e1e6b96173e012d7a67
- address
- bc1q989jftrhjvyl83jt3c0xh9sh8cqj67n8na5wrs